Description

Check out this cozy updated farmhouse in the heart of Lowell! Welcomed in through the adorable front covered porch you will see this home features a formal dining room; an inviting living room; spacious kitchen with newer counters, white cabinets, subway tile, stainless appliances; crown molding & hard floors. Convenient primary bedroom with a walk through to the full bath. The main laundry doubles as a nice mudroom with door leading to the newly fenced-in backyard. Upstairs you will find the 2nd bedroom and a third walk through bedroom. Freshly painted 1 stall garage, beautiful mature trees & fire pit awaits outdoors. Additional amenities include a newer AC & furnace, metal roof and only 20min from downtown Grand Rapids. Seller has called for highest and best 6:00pm on Friday, Feb 16.

223 Maple St, Lowell, MI 49331 is a 3 bedroom, 1 bathroom, 1,082 sqft single-family home built in 1900. This property is not currently available for sale. 223 Maple St was last sold on Apr 1, 2024 for $227,000 (3% higher than the asking price of $220,000). The current Trulia Estimate for 223 Maple St is $236,000.
